Rain or Shine forward Santi Santillan drops by The DVD Show to elaborate on his basketball journey that started in Lapu-Lapu, Cebu. He talks about how he was discovered by the University of Visayas before he flourished as a phenomenal role player on the squad. Additionally, he pinpoints the particular event wherein La Salle recruited him as he decided to take his talents to Taft. Santi emphasizes the gratefulness and enjoyment he experienced with the Green and White, especially the privilege of playing with Ben Mbala. Lastly, he also discusses his adjustment to the PBA and continuing to thrive in the environment of the Elasto Painters.
